📰 Introduction to USA Today

USA Today is a prominent American daily middle-market newspaper and news broadcasting company, known for its concise reports, colorized images, and inclusion of popular culture stories. Founded by Al Neuharth in 1980, the newspaper has become a staple in American journalism, with its corporate headquarters located in New York City. The paper's dynamic design has influenced the style of local, regional, and national newspapers worldwide, making it a significant player in the media industry. With its wide reach and diverse coverage, USA Today has become a go-to source for news and information, competing with other major newspapers like The New York Times and The Washington Post. 📊 History and Founding

The history of USA Today dates back to 1980 when Al Neuharth, a renowned journalist and entrepreneur, founded the company. The newspaper was launched on September 14, 1982, with the goal of providing a fresh and innovative approach to news reporting. With its unique design and features, USA Today quickly gained popularity and became a leading national newspaper. The paper's early success can be attributed to its focus on concise reports, colorized images, and informational graphics, which set it apart from other newspapers.
